apb
noun
ˈeɪˌpiːˈbiː

Definition
An all-points bulletin, often used in law enforcement contexts to request assistance in locating a person or vehicle.

Examples
- The police issued an APB for the suspect after the robbery.
- After the car theft, an APB was sent out to all nearby patrol units.
- The detective said that an APB would help increase the chances of finding the missing person.

Meaning
An urgent broadcast sent to law enforcement agencies to inform them about a suspect or a dangerous situation.
